DISEASES OF THE RESPIRATORY ORGANS.
Importance of diseases of the respiratory organs—in horses and dogs.
Proclivity through over-exertion, through extent and delicacy of the
mucosa, through changes of temperature, through weather, through air
pollution, through kind of diet, through change of latitude, through
nervous sympathy, through debilitation of the lung tissue, through
suppression of perspiration, through a high dew point, through
bacteria and other germs, through youth and change of habits.
These are among the most frequent and grave of all affections of the
domestic animals. They are especially important however in the case of
animals that depend on the soundness of their wind. In horses and dogs
accordingly any permanent injury to the organs of respiration will
seriously impair the value, not only because of the diminished
usefulness of the affected animal, but also because of the probable
deterioration of their progeny. The rapid paces demanded of these
animals and the strain to which the respiratory organs are subject are
potent causes of respiratory disorder. In all animals, however, the
extent of the respiratory surface and its extreme delicacy and tenuity
especially predispose it to disease. Hales estimates that the mucous
membrane covering all the air sacs and air cells is, in the calf, no
less than 250 square feet. As the chest of the horse is at least double
that of the calf, and as it contains much less connective tissue, and is
made up of minute air cells from ¹⁄₇₀–¹⁄₂₀₀ inch in diameter and
separated from each other by walls so attenuated that the contained
capillary bloodvessels are equally exposed to the air on both sides, in
two adjacent air cells, the estimate for the average horse must be
considerably above 500 square feet. This membrane, incomparably the most
delicate and susceptible in the animal economy, is constantly in contact
with the air in all its variable conditions, and is necessarily affected
by these variations.
